Plasmapheresis is a medical procedure that involves the separation and removal of plasma from the blood, a process that can help treat a variety of diseases. Plasma is the liquid component of blood, containing water, electrolytes, proteins, hormones, and waste products. The main cause for performing plasmapheresis typically relates to conditions where an abnormal level of antibodies or other harmful substances in the plasma contributes to a patient's illness. This can include autoimmune disorders, such as Guillain-Barré syndrome and myasthenia gravis, where the immune system mistakenly attacks the body's own tissues. Other indications for plasmapheresis include certain types of kidney disease, such as nephrotic syndrome, and conditions like thrombotic thrombocytopenic purpura (TTP) and lupus. The symptoms that may prompt the need for plasmapheresis vary depending on the underlying condition but often include fatigue, weakness, muscle pain, and neurological impairments. In autoimmune diseases, symptoms can include tingling sensations, muscle cramps, and difficulty breathing, which reflect the body's confusion between self and non-self. During the procedure, blood is drawn from the patient and passed through a machine that separates the plasma from the blood cells. The plasma is then replaced with either a substitute solution, such as saline or albumin, or it may be returned directly to the patient, allowing for the removal of the harmful substances. Plasmapheresis is usually performed in a hospital or specialized clinic and may require multiple sessions depending on the severity of the condition being treated. While generally considered safe, it does have potential side effects, which can include infections, allergic reactions, and changes in blood pressure. Monitoring during and after the procedure is essential to manage these risks adequately. Overall, plasmapheresis plays a significant role in the management of certain health conditions by helping to alleviate symptoms and promote recovery, making it a valuable tool in modern medicine.
